引言在网页开发中,动态加载数据是一个常见的需求。传统的页面刷新方式会带来用户体验上的不便。jQuery AJAX技术提供了一种无需刷新页面的方式来更新网页内容。本文将详细介绍jQuery AJAX的原...
在网页开发中,动态加载数据是一个常见的需求。传统的页面刷新方式会带来用户体验上的不便。jQuery AJAX技术提供了一种无需刷新页面的方式来更新网页内容。本文将详细介绍jQuery AJAX的原理、用法以及如何实现无刷新更新网页数据。
AJAX(Asynchronous JavaScript and XML)是一种在不需要重新加载整个页面的情况下,与服务器交换数据和更新部分网页的技术。jQuery AJAX利用jQuery库提供的便捷方法,简化了AJAX的实现过程。
jQuery AJAX通过JavaScript的原生XMLHttpRequest对象与服务器进行通信。以下是AJAX请求的基本流程:
XMLHttpRequest对象。jQuery提供了$.ajax()方法来简化AJAX请求的发送过程。以下是一些常用的参数:
url:请求的URL。type:请求的类型(GET、POST等)。data:发送到服务器的数据。dataType:预期的服务器返回的数据类型(json、xml等)。success:请求成功后的回调函数。error:请求失败后的回调函数。以下是一个使用jQuery AJAX实现无刷新更新网页数据的示例:
无刷新更新数据
这里将显示更新后的数据
在上面的示例中,点击按钮后,会发送一个GET请求到update.php文件。服务器处理请求后,返回JSON格式的数据。在success回调函数中,我们将返回的数据更新到页面上的dataContainer元素中。
jQuery AJAX技术为网页开发带来了极大的便利,使得动态加载和更新网页内容成为可能。通过本文的介绍,相信读者已经掌握了jQuery AJAX的基本原理和用法。在实际开发中,灵活运用jQuery AJAX可以提升用户体验,使网页更加动态和交互。